Chronic aches and pains often build slowly over time — from daily stress, repetitive movement, or long hours in one position.

Massage offers a gentle way to help the body release tension and restore balance.

Massage may help:
• Ease muscle tension
• Improve mobility
• Increase circulation
• Calm the nervous system

Deep Tissue vs. Deep Pressure — What’s the Difference?

These two terms are often used interchangeably, but they’re not the same thing.

Deep Pressure
Deep pressure simply means using firmer, heavier pressure during a massage. It can be applied during a full-body Swedish session and is always adjusted to your comfort level.
It’s about intensity of touch.

Deep Tissue
Deep tissue is a specific, focused therapeutic approach.
It targets particular muscles, adhesions, or patterns of restriction using slower, intentional techniques. It’s not about working the entire body deeply — it’s about addressing a specific issue with precision.
It’s about clinical intention and focus.

At Elysium On Whidbey – Massage & Bodywork, I offer:
• Swedish massage with light to firm pressure
• Focused deep tissue work when there’s a specific area needing therapeutic attention

You don’t need full-body deep pressure to get effective results. Often, slower and more intentional creates deeper change.
